What to check before for buildings without rodents in Bedford-Stuyvesant

  • Expect buildings that have documented no-rodent issues as per NYC open records.
  • Always confirm with the building about their pest control policies and practices.
  • Consider asking about recent pest inspections to ensure ongoing management efforts.
  • Review building policies regarding potential fees for maintenance or pest control services.
  • Check the overall condition of common areas, as they can signal the likelihood of pest issues.
